What the Image Color Picker does
Pick a pixel out of a picture and read its colour as HEX, RGB and HSL, ready to copy. The image is drawn onto a canvas in this browser and each pick reads that one pixel back.
Click or tap the picture, or focus it and move the pick with the arrow keys — one pixel a step, ten with Shift held. The colours picked during this visit stay in a row underneath until the tab closes.
When the colour is in the picture
When something has to match: the exact blue in a logo you were sent as a PNG, the background of a screenshot you are extending, the accent colour of a photograph you are building a page around. The value is in the file; this reads it out.
It is also the fastest way to check what a colour actually is rather than what it looks like. Two greys that look identical on screen are rarely the same grey, and the numbers settle it.
How to pick, and what you get
One pixel, three notations, and a short memory.
- Pointer or touch
- Click or tap a pixel. Holding the button down and dragging keeps picking as you move, so a colour can be found by sweeping across an area rather than by aiming at it.
- Keyboard
- Focus the picture and use the arrow keys: one pixel a step, ten with Shift. The picture starts on its middle pixel, so there is always a colour to move from rather than an empty panel to aim at.
- HEX, RGB and HSL
- The same colour in the three notations CSS takes, each with a copy button. A grey is reported with a hue of zero, because every hue produces a grey and naming one would be inventing it.
- The colours you picked
- The last eight, newest first, each copyable by clicking it. Picking the same colour twice moves it rather than duplicating it. They are held in the page and nothing is stored: closing the tab forgets them.

Why is the hue of my grey zero?
Because a grey has no hue: every hue produces it once the saturation is zero. Reporting zero is the convention browsers use too, and it is more honest than printing whatever the arithmetic left behind.

The colour is slightly different from the original. Why?
A lossy format changes pixels: a JPEG of a flat colour is a field of very slightly different colours. What you get is what is actually in the file, which is what any other picker on the same file would also report.
